Improving standards of scheme governance and administration

As part of our continued commitment to the good governance of pension schemes, the National Pensions Group has undertaken a survey and produced a quality publication covering specific aspects of governance such as data integrity and internal controls in relation to the administration of a pension scheme. This follows the publication of our investment governance surveys in 2008 and 2009.

For this particular topic, the National Pensions Team surveyed close to 50 schemes on their risk management framework, scheme governance, the integrity of their member date and their risk and control procedures.

With the Pensions Regulator focusing on improving standards in pension scheme governance and administration, there comes the need for schemes to revisit their risk register to confirm that they reflect the risks associated with data integrity, quality and accuracy of data and communication to members.
